1.4301, also known as AISI 304, is a widely applied austenitic stainless steel round rod , prized for its outstanding corrosion resistance and adaptability . Its makeup typically includes around 18% chromium and 8% nickel, providing a polished finish and good formability. Common implementations span various industries , including food processing equipment, architectural features, medical apparatus, hardware, and structural supports . The round profile facilitates ease of fabrication while maintaining structural integrity in demanding environments.

Stainless Steel Round Bar Sizing and Tolerances: A Reference for Engineers
Accurate sizing of stainless steel round rod is crucial for successful engineering designs . This reference outlines common dimensions and associated variations encountered in the industry. Standard offerings typically range from very small fractions of an inch to significant large diameters, often expressed using both imperial and metric systems. Common sizing is presented as nominal width , followed by a tolerance designation – for example, 1” +/- 0.032”. Stricter tolerances increase manufacturing cost and may limit material production. Specific industry standards such as ASTM A519 or EN 10088 dictate acceptable deviations; always consult the relevant standard for your specific application requirement. Consider also that surface finish can influence apparent size , particularly when using precision instruments. Material grade and manufacturing process (e.g., hot rolled, cold drawn) will further affect achievable tolerances.
